Xrandr Not All Resolutions Seen
So I have two monitors, a laptop monitor and an lcd which I use as a second screen when my laptop is docked, and I'm able to set it up with xrandr to set it up to work fine-ish. The code I use is
Code:
xrandr --output VGA --right-of LVDS --mode 1024x768
And it works, and my monitor is now right of the laptop screen. The problem I'm having is when I do xrandr -q to find out what all the resolutions are for the VGA I don't see the highest one of 1280x1024 instead I see:
Code:
VGA connected 1024x768+1280+0 (normal left inverted right x axis y axis) 338mm x 270mm
1152x768 54.8
1024x768 60.0*
832x624 74.6
800x600 72.2 75.0 60.3 56.2
640x480 85.0 72.8 75.0 60.0
720x400 85.0
640x400 85.1
640x350 85.1
Any ideas how I can get this up to the optimal resolution.?
